Output 64de3cece254247efd9e844e49bf41ac795099833edf09a80725986040ced2de:0

value
38389019
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1f1c66d3f5d21a902695732010382965dbe55f18 OP_EQUALVERIFY OP_CHECKSIG
address
13qVyL7QvAohNM2z312MP4XQALK12RUyLH
transaction
64de3cece254247efd9e844e49bf41ac795099833edf09a80725986040ced2de
confirmations
416375
spent
true